getPreferredYRange
Description copied from interface:ChartRendererOptional Y-range override for autoscaling.Renderers may return a {minY, maxY} array when the visible range should be based on derived data rather than the model's raw Y-values (e.g. indicators like MACD).
- Parameters:
model- the layer model- Returns:
- {minY, maxY} or null to use model Y-values
